Coorg

If you want to feast your eyes on stunning scenic beauty, Coorg is the next destination you should plan a trip to. Nestled amidst the gorgeous hills and mountains, the place has earned much popularity among South India tours and travels for coffee production. Coorg offers panoramic scenes of the Western Ghats with beautiful green hills and streams. If you ever happen to visit Coorg, don’t miss the Golden Temple, and watching sunrise and sunset at the Raja's Seat.

Wayanad

Peacefully tucked in the hills of Western Ghats, Wayanad attracts travellers majorly for its Nilgiri Biosphere Reserve. However, the place offers more than this, and no wonder why it is often considered the prettiest attractions in Kerala. The quaint town is famous for its spice plantation, historical caves, cascading waterfalls, comfy resorts, homestays, and exotic wildlife. Hampi

The UNESCO World Heritage site is one of the most visited pilgrimage destinations of India. The place boasts of magnificent ancient temple complexes and ruins of the Vijayanagara Empire. Hampi is home to ‘Group of Monuments’ including Krishna Temple complex, Vitthala temple complex, Lotus Mahal complex, and more.

Rameshwaram

Though Rameshwaram is considered a holy place in India, it is visited by local and foreign tourists alike. According to Hindu mythology, Rameshwaram is the place where Lord Rama created the bridge to cross the sea to reach Sri Lanka. Even if we keep the mythological importance aside, the place is magnificent for its massive sculptured pillars and is an ideal escapade to spirituality.
